Evergreen Keywords That Actually Work

Evergreen keywords are your foundation. These are searches that happen consistently year-round, and they matter just as much for POD as anything else.

The key is combining the product with the use case or recipient:

Notice the pattern. Each one has: product type + descriptor + buyer motivation. "T-shirt" is too broad. "Personalized t-shirt" is better. "Personalized dog mom t-shirt" is where the buyers actually are.

For evergreen keywords, look at what problems or occasions your designs solve. Are they gifts for new parents? Teacher gifts? Office decor? Bachelorette party items? Start there, then add the product type.

Evergreen keywords won't spike in search volume, but they're consistent. You'll get steady traffic if you rank well for them. And they tend to have lower competition than pure seasonal keywords.

Tactical Keyword Recommendations

Here's what actually works when you're optimizing POD listings:

1. Test the "For" + Recipient approach

People search for who they're buying for, not just what it is. "Mug for coffee lovers," "shirt for introverts," "blanket for someone who loves cats." Layer this into your tags and descriptions. It's a common pattern that signals strong buyer intent.

2. Use adjective + product combinations

"Minimalist mug," "retro t-shirt," "personalized canvas," "unisex hoodie." Adjectives filter out browsers and attract buyers looking for something specific. They're goldmines for POD.

3. Mix product type keywords with lifestyle keywords

Don't just target "t-shirt." Target "t-shirt" plus lifestyle keywords: "weekend vibes tee," "work from home shirt," "gym apparel," "lounge wear." This catches people at the moment they're thinking about what they need.

4. Add the customization angle

"Personalized," "custom," and "monogrammed" are huge for POD. People specifically search for these because they want something unique. Include them naturally in your listing copy and tags if your product offers customization.

5. Research competitor gaps strategically

Look at what's ranking for your niche keywords. See the 5-10 top listings. Then ask: what keywords aren't they using that their products could match? What buyer needs are they missing? That's where you can slip in and rank.

The Tools and Process

Finding these keywords means researching actual search behavior. Etsy's search bar is your starting point. Type in a base keyword (like "mug for dog lovers") and see what autocomplete suggestions appear. Those are real searches people make.

Look at your competitors' listings too. Check what tags and titles successful shops use. You're not copying them, but you're understanding the keyword landscape.

For deeper analysis, dedicated tools help you see search volume and competition levels.
